Features
Table 1 lists the features of the DSP56309 device.
Freescale Semiconductor
Internal Peripherals
High-Performance
Power Dissipation
Internal Memories
External Memory
DSP56300 Core
Expansion
Packaging
Feature
• 100 million multiply-accumulates per second (MMACS) with a 100 MHz clock at 3.3 V nominal
• Data arithmetic logic unit (Data ALU) with fully pipelined 24 × 24-bit parallel multiplier-accumulator (MAC),
• Program control unit (PCU) with position-independent code (PIC) support, addressing modes optimized for
• Direct memory access (DMA) with six DMA channels supporting internal and external accesses; one-, two-
• Phase-lock loop (PLL) allows change of low-power divide factor (DF) without loss of lock and output clock
• Hardware debugging support including On-Chip Emulation (OnCE‘) module, Joint Test Action Group
• Enhanced 8-bit parallel host interface (HI08) supports a variety of buses (for example, ISA) and provides
• Two enhanced synchronous serial interfaces (ESSI), each with one receiver and three transmitters (allows
• Serial communications interface (SCI) with baud rate generator
• Triple timer module
• Up to thirty-four programmable general-purpose input/output (GPIO) pins, depending on which peripherals
• 192 × 24-bit bootstrap ROM
• 8 K × 24-bit RAM total
• Program RAM, instruction cache, X data RAM, and Y data RAM sizes are programmable:
Program RAM
• Data memory expansion to two 256 K × 24-bit word memory spaces using the standard external address
• Program memory expansion to one 256 K × 24-bit words memory space using the standard external
• External memory expansion port
• Chip select logic for glueless interface to static random access memory (SRAMs)
• Internal DRAM Controller for glueless interface to dynamic random access memory (DRAMs)
• Very low-power CMOS design
• Wait and Stop low-power standby modes
• Fully static design specified to operate down to 0 Hz (dc)
• Optimized power management circuitry (instruction-dependent, peripheral-dependent, and mode-
• 144-pin TQFP package in lead-free or lead-bearing versions
• 196-pin molded array plastic-ball grid array (MAP-BGA) package in lead-free or lead-bearing versions
